Family immigration

TAKE THE FIRST STEPS TOWARD REUNITING YOUR FAMILY

We are knowledgeabale about all kinds of family immigration petitions/visas:

- Spouse petitions

- One-Step applications

- Petitions for siblings

- Petitions for Parents

- Petitions for children and step childen

- Fiance visa

- Consular Processing 

Waivers of Inadmissibility

We help clients obtain waivers of inadmissibility due to issues such as entering the U.S without inspection, past criminal convictions, immigration violations, or certain medical conditions.

  •  E-2 Investor Visa

The E2 Visa is a great option for investors and entrepreneurs. With an E2 visa, you can live in the United States, start a US business, and work for your business. It is only available to people from certain countries that have an E2 treaty with the United States. To qualify for the E-2 Visa, you must invest a substantial amount of capital into a US business and you must direct and develop that business. You can either start a new business or invest in an existing business.

As long as as the E2 business continues to operate and meet the E2 visa requirements, and E2 visa holder can continue to renew their visa and live and work in the United States.

  •  L-1A and L-1B visa

The L1 visa allows foreign businesses to transfer certain employees to a US branch, parent, subsidiary, or affiliate company.

The employee that is transferred must work for the US company as a manager, executive, or person with specialized knowledge. If the employee will work as a manager or an executive, the visa is specifically called an L1A visa. If the employee will work as a person with specialized knowledge, the visa is specifically called an L1B visa.

The L1A visa for managers and executives is initially valid for a period of 3 years and can be extended for a total of 7 years.

The L1B visa for people with specialized knowledge is initially valid for a period of 3 years and can be extended for a total of 5 years.

  • L-1 New Office

A new office is a company that has been doing business in the US through a parent, branch, affiliate, or subsidiary for less than one year.

Asylum

If you suffered persecution based on your race, ethnicity, religion, social membership, or political opinion in your country of origin or if you fear future persecution, you have the right to apply for asylum and we can help you throughout this complex and lengthy process. Whether you are seeking asylum from Syria, Tunisia, Ukraine or any other country across the globe, our firm is equipped to assist you each step of the way.

VAWA

Qualifying for Permanent Residence under the Violence Against Women Act (VAWA). A VAWA victim of domestic violence or a qualifying child or parent of such a victim may be eligible for permanent residence (a green card) under VAWA. Applicants do not have to be female. 

1. A self-petition for lawful permanent residence is available to spouses or former spouses and children of U.S. citizens or legal permanent residents. It is also available to parents of adult U.S. citizens. A current or former spouse may file if his or her children were abused by the U.S. citizen or legal permanent resident.

2. A battered spouse or child waiver is available for those who have conditional legal permanent residence as a spouse, or under certain circumstances, as a child or parent of a U.S. citizen or legal permanent resident.

3. A VAWA cancellation of removal is possible. This is available to applicants who are currently in removal (deportation) proceedings.

U-Visa

A U Visa is offered to aliens who have been victims of a crime, and have assisted, are assisting, or will assist in the investigation and prosecution of the defendant, a suspect, or any other person who committed the crime. The U Visa victim must have suffered substantial physical or mental abuse.

  • The crime must have taken place within the United States.
  • The victim must have filed a criminal report with a law enforcement agency regarding the crime.
  • The victim must have suffered significant mental or physical abuse as a result of the crime
  • The victim or the victim’s children will suffer if removed or deported from the United States
